How to Get a Truck Driving License in Poland
Truck driving is a very important job in Poland and is a job that pays well. It is a great opportunity to build experience and explore around the world.
However, becoming a truck driver in Poland requires a number of steps. This article will walk you through the steps to get your Code 95 which is required to work professionally in road transportation.
Qualifications
Driving a truck in Poland offers numerous advantages. They include competitive pay and the chance to travel to new places. It is important to know the qualifications required to become a professional truck driver. Drivers who are interested in driving trucks need to have a valid license and undergo special training. Drivers must also possess an official document that proves their professional status known as the Driver Qualification Card, or Karta Kwalifikacji Kerowcy (code 95).
The applicant must also pass a physical test to determine if they are physically fit enough to drive. In addition, they must take a written test that is available in several languages, to prove their knowledge of traffic laws and safety regulations. They must also complete a course of training with an instructor certified. These classes are designed to enhance the skills of truck drivers and increase their confidence behind the steering wheel.
Drivers must hold a Category C or C+E driver's license to drive vehicles in Poland. The category of driver's license is based on the weight of the vehicle and trailer that can be attached to it. The license is valid for three years and is renewed two years after the expiration date. All drivers must keep tachograph records according to European law.

Exams
Before you can drive a truck professionally in Poland you must pass a number of exams. This includes a medical exam, theory exam, practical driving lessons, and an examination for the category you're applying to. The test covers traffic rules road signs, traffic rules, and safety rules. The test is available in multiple languages, which means non-Polish speakers are also able to take the test. You will also need to take a series of driving lessons with a licensed instructor. The lessons can be arranged at an online driving school or at a driving school. After passing the test on the road, you can begin working as trucker in Poland.
You must also have a valid national or international driver's license. In addition, you must possess a professional certificate of competence (code 95). This is required for truck drivers that want to work in Poland. You can get it from a driving school or WORD (Wojewodzki Osrodek Ruchudrogowego).
